Kidney beans

Phaseolus vulgaris

Also known as Red kidney bean, Rajma

The large red-skinned variety of the common bean, and the one carrying the highest concentration of the toxic lectin phytohaemagglutinin when raw. The USDA reference entry is for the raw dry bean, which roughly triples in weight when boiled.

How preparation changes things

Only effects with real support are listed. If a preparation method is missing, it is because nothing dependable is documented — not because it makes no difference.

  • boiledReduces phytohaemagglutinin

    A vigorous boil of at least ten minutes destroys phytohaemagglutinin. Temperatures below boiling, as in a slow cooker on low, can leave the lectin active or even more toxic than in the raw bean, which is why the boiling step is not optional.

  • soakedReduces oligosaccharides and phytate

    Soaking for several hours and discarding the water removes part of the gas-forming oligosaccharides and lowers phytate, in addition to shortening cooking time.

  • cookedIncreases resistant starch

    Cooking and cooling increases resistant starch through retrogradation, which is retained on reheating.

Things to know

Allergies, interactions and intake concerns. Every food gets this section — a reference where everything is uniformly good is not a reference.

  • Avoid

    Phytohaemagglutinin poisoning from undercooked beans

    Raw and undercooked red kidney beans cause acute vomiting and diarrhoea within a few hours, and as few as four or five raw beans have been enough. Dried beans must be soaked for at least five hours, the soaking water discarded, and the beans then boiled vigorously for at least ten minutes before simmering to tenderness. Slow cookers are the classic hazard, because temperatures below boiling can increase toxicity rather than reduce it. Canned kidney beans have already been heat-processed and are safe as sold.

  • Worth knowing

    FODMAPs and IBS

    Kidney beans are among the highest-FODMAP pulses and a common cause of bloating and pain in irritable bowel syndrome. Rinsing canned beans and using small portions is the usual approach.

  • Worth knowing

    Lectin-free eating is not evidence-based

    Popular books recommend avoiding all lectin-containing foods. The genuine hazard is specific and preparation-dependent: raw or undercooked beans. Properly cooked beans carry no meaningful lectin activity, and the broader elimination diet has no supporting human evidence.

  • Worth knowing

    Phytate and mineral absorption

    Kidney bean phytate reduces absorption of iron and zinc from the meal; vitamin C alongside improves non-heme iron uptake.
